Jun 19, 2024 · The palace theater in the New Palace is located in Sanssouci Park in Potsdam and has a 250-year history. It was built between 1763 and 1769 by order of Frederick the Great and is a masterpiece of the Rococo style, designed by Carl von Gontard.
3 days ago · Historic buildings include the old castle (13th century; rebuilt 1553–78), housing the Landesmuseum; the new palace (1746–1807); the Rosenstein Palace (1824–29), now the natural history museum; the Gothic Leonhardskirche (1463–74), of the hall type; and the Stiftskirche (collegiate church), a 12th-century Romanesque basilica completed ...
